Among fishers in the United States, freshwater fish species are usually classified by the water temperature in which they survive. The water temperature affects the amount of oxygen available as cold water contains more oxygen than warm water. Coldwater fish species survive in the coldest temperatures, preferring a water temperature of 50 to 60 °F (10–16 °C). Instead of having slimy skin like a catfish or a coating of scales like most other fish, the White Sturgeon is covered in hard, bony plates called scutes. They also share a trait in common with sharks: an internal frame made out of cartilage instead of bone.

This turns anglers towards more reliable … Web14 de mar. de 2024 · Redear Sunfish ( Lepomis microlophus ) Average size: 8.5 inches. Redears are native to the Gulf Coast and southeastern US up to North Carolina. These days, you can also find them in the Great Lakes, as well as a few western fisheries. Redears boast small mouths relative to the size of their bodies.
